Transaction 68f31f27414610d5e89d3a27bf158c6290c822fe1d34e88f28f4c4dc2d9610bc

3 Input
2 Outputs
  • 68f31f27414610d5e89d3a27bf158c6290c822fe1d34e88f28f4c4dc2d9610bc:0
  • value  652494
    address  151DgTvSxDExaqNRqQfJh9FWk1vBEHMWpq
  • 68f31f27414610d5e89d3a27bf158c6290c822fe1d34e88f28f4c4dc2d9610bc:1
  • value  1057574
    address  1AHpL2ScgHw2HNvotXv3KNzNGWt7fAtodx